Handover Note — Marketing Budget Cut

From: Director Pell Ashover. To: incoming director.

Budget for the Northvale region cut eighteen percent, effective immediately. Sponsorships at the Carden trade fairs cancelled; penalties already negotiated down. Digital spend protected for the Merrow launch only. Agency retainer with Bluecroft Media renegotiated to month-to-month. Headcount untouched for now, but two contractor roles end at quarter close. Track savings weekly and report to finance. The underlying plan driving these cuts is noted below.

board note of kafog-fawep: The pricing group signed off on a budget of $7.1 million for Project Lamion. The renewal with Gilathix Holdings closes at $60.4 million a year, 43 percent below the last contract.

### SDK Parity Check (Kestrel vs. Lanternfly)

Welcome aboard! Before shipping anything, run the parity script — it diffs the public API surface of the Kestrel (mobile) and Lanternfly (web) SDKs and flags anything one has that the other doesn't. Don't hand-wave mismatches; file them, even tiny ones. When the script passes, paste its output into the tracker along with the build token printed below.

build token for yahig-haduf: htk9_c784e8425

To the release manager: I'm passing ownership of the Pellwick deep-link router to Sorrel before the 4.2 cut. The intent-matching table now lives in the Farrowgate config service; stale entries were purged last sprint. Watch the fallback route — it silently swallows malformed slugs, which inflated our drop-off metrics in March. The staging resolver needs its keystore unlocked before each regression pass, and that keystore accepts only one credential. For the signing vault, the recovery phrase is noted directly below.

recovery phrase for tafog-fafog: novix-novdor-fraath-brieth-olieth-oliix-rusix-wenion-julax-druox

## Changelog — Ticktrace 1.9

### Renamed: DRIFT_API_TOKEN
During the cron drift investigation we found plugins confusing this variable with the metrics token, so it has been renamed to indicate it authorizes drift-report uploads specifically. Plugin authors must read the new name from 1.9 onward; the old name is ignored without warning. Sample env files in the SDK are updated. In your deployment env file, the drift-report upload secret is set on the next line.

env line for fawef-taguf: VAULT_KEY13=a9695905a9a90